Transaction

74446d0c2593d89e03b80ff4d197b9c6d68b6c2bad9dc8155276e0fe3fa04560

Summary

In Block255036
TimeTue, 04 Jul 2023 20:19:15 UTC
Total Input565.70703125 Nebula
Total Output620.70703125 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
425031 Confirmations620.70703125 Nebula
Raw Transaction